0514-86177077
9:00-17:00(工作日)
問題描述:
在網站開發中,需要經常開啟一些定時任務,例如定時清理臟數據等。本文主要介紹使用laravel自帶的Task Scheduling配合cron實現定時任務。
編寫定時任務
在laravel框架的App\Console\Kernel.php目錄下編寫你需要執行的定時任務。例如:
$schedule->call(function () { XXXXXX })->hourly();
程序會一個小時執行一次。
開啟定時任務
在linxu系統下開啟定時任務只需要兩步:
打開crontab,執行:crontab -e
添加定時任務,* * * * * php /path/to/artisan schedule:run >> /dev/null 2>1。這個語句是每分鐘執行一次schedule。
以上這篇Laravel框架實現定時Task Scheduling例子就是小編分享給大家的全部內容了,希望能給大家一個參考,也希望大家多多支持腳本之家。
標簽:香港 佳木斯 金華 自貢 寶雞 阿克蘇 通化 郴州
上一篇:laravel 解決強制跳轉 https的問題
下一篇:Laravel定時任務的每秒執行代碼
Copyright ? 1999-2012 誠信 合法 規范的巨人網絡通訊始建于2005年
蘇ICP備15040257號-8